Long-term health conditions and the need for help with everyday activities.
More people in postcode 4129 now need help with daily activities than a decade ago, with the rate rising to 5.5%. While overall health is similar to the state average, the area has a notably high rate of mental health conditions.
Long-term conditions people report.
Mental health conditions affect 10.7% of residents, which is much higher than most areas and slightly above the national figure of 8.8%. Long-term health conditions overall are reported by 29.7% of the population, with asthma and arthritis being other common issues.

People needing help with daily activities.
About 5.5% of people in the area need assistance with daily activities. This is about the same as the figures for Queensland and Australia, though the rate has risen by 2.4 percentage points since 2011.
